I have sms loaded in my old resource domain, how would I go about using it to migrate users and computer into the new single master domain. Do I need to set up a secondary site on the new resource domain?

Also is there a way to use sms to change the time on clients like a time server. Cause to change the time you have to be an admin on your local computer and we don't want to give that to the users.

Thanks for the help
 
I know this is an old post but this reply may help a few. We set time on remote computers by using the NET TIME \\server /set /y command this will set the time to what ever the time is on the "Server". Run this during the logon script and it should sync the client time with the server.
